Fill in the blank with the most appropriate word which will suit the context of the sentence.

Many employers like to visit college campuses and ______ college seniors to work for their companies.

The correct answer is

Recruit

Understanding the Sentence Context: Employers and College Seniors

The sentence discusses the practice of employers visiting college campuses. The goal is to find and bring in college seniors to work for their respective companies. We need to find the word that best describes this action.

Analyzing the Word Options

Let's look at each option to see how it fits the sentence:

  • Daunt: This word means to discourage someone. Employers visiting campuses usually want to attract students, not discourage them. So, 'daunt' does not fit the context.
  • Recruit: This word means to try to persuade someone to join a company or organization, often by visiting places like college campuses. This perfectly matches the scenario described where employers seek to hire college seniors.
  • Entrust: This means to give a responsibility or task to someone you trust. While an employer might later entrust work to a hired senior, the initial act of bringing them into the company is not described by 'entrust'.
  • Enroll: This word usually means to register or admit someone into a program or institution, like enrolling in a college course. Employers don't 'enroll' people into their companies; they hire or recruit them.

Selecting the Most Appropriate Word

Based on the analysis, the action employers take when visiting college campuses to hire students is best described as recruiting. They are trying to attract and select talented college seniors for their job openings. Therefore, 'Recruit' is the most suitable word to fill in the blank.

The completed sentence reads: "Many employers like to visit college campuses and recruit college seniors to work for their companies."
